Boris Kovac is unitary of a handful of modern composers and performers from the part of Hungary, Bulgaria, and Yugoslavia whose names reached Western Europe and America. Strongly influenced by folks music from that region (a captivation he shares with István Mártha and Ernö Király), minimum art, Bela Bartok, and the school of view of Bela Hamvas (too influential on Hungarian composer Tibor Szemzö), Kovac's music takes multiple forms. His production pot buoy be split in triad categories: the deep unearthly cycles he writes for his ensemble Rite Nova; more formal contemporaneous sleeping accommodation music for dance and theater; and eventually his LaDaABa Orchest, a party band for the end of the world.


Kovac was born in 1955 in the Vojvodina region, at the extreme northwest point of Yugoslavia. Bordered by Hungary, this region historically enjoyed an sovereign status until the Yugoslavian war of the early '90s when it was annexed by Slobodan Milosevic. Kovac's parents made him take accordion lessons when he was a youngster, just it only light-emitting diode him toward academic music and, besides one yr of study on sax, he is self-taught on a wide array of instruments.


In 1977, Kovac formed the ECM-style jazz mathematical group Meta Sekcija, his number 1 project. Things became serious with the shaping of Ritual Nova in 1982, which included within its ranks keyboardist Stevan Kovacz Tickmayer. With this chemical group Kovac would explore a highly original grade of composition, blending ancient traditions and postmodern techniques to press out spiritual ideals like fraternal love life and peace; a reaction to the difficult multiplication Yugoslavia would go through and through for the next decennary and a half. Kovac released his commencement LP, Ritual Nova, in 1986 on the low Yugoslavian label Symposion. The English label Recommended picked it up for distribution and released its 1989 followup in its Eastern-European series Points East.


Political instability sent Kovac and his mathematical group into expat in 1991. For the future quintet days, Kovac lived in Italy, Austria, and Slovenia. During this period he worked for the most part for the theatre and began cultivate on Recollection: Ecumenical Mysteries. This cycle (his to the highest degree profoundly spiritual to date) became in 1996 the number one of deuce albums for the Canadian label Victo. That year, Kovac resettled in his home base town Novi Sad. In 1997, he participated in the Festival International de Musique Actuelle de Victoriaville and toured the reality with his supporting players. Meanwhile, he struggled to reconstruct a originative music scene in his region. Prompted by the NATO bombardments in Kosovo and the abiding instability of the region, he formed La Danza Apocalyptica Balcanica (or LaDaABa Orchest) in 2001, a zany dance palace orchestra to exorcize the rabidity of war. The mathematical group released its number one album, The Last Balkan Tango, later that yr.

Beatles' management contract up for auction

The Beatles' first contract with coach Brian Epstein is expected to bring up to �250,000 when it is auctioned off in London adjacent month.

Epstein's personal copy of the narrow, dated January 24, 1962, bears the signatures of the Fab Four and two of their fathers, since McCartney and Harrison were under 21 at the time.

The sums byzantine are dwarfed by the contract's estimated value today. Epstein would receive a quarter of the band's earnings - but only if they each made over �200 per workweek. If they had failed to rake in those kinds of riches, he stood to make just 20%, dropping to 15% if their earnings dipped below �100.

As a sign of his dedication, Epstein refused to sign the contract himself until he had delivered their first record contract, and only felt able to put pen to paper following the deal with EMI on October 1, 1962 for the tone ending of Love Me Do.

But upon the release of the Beatles Anthology book in 2000, the surviving band members revealed that Epstein had originally wanted them to sign a �50 per-week lifelong cover, with Epstein keeping the rest of their royalties for himself.

As well as arranging publicizing and publicity, the contract requires Epstein to advise the "artists" on all matters concerning clothes, make up, and the presentation and construction of the artists' acts. Epstein had already proved successful in this respect - on his advice, the band ditched their leather jackets and blue jeans in favor of sharp suits and the now-iconic haircuts.

Epstein, who ascertained the band at the infamous Cavern Club in Liverpool, was to remain a key figure in the Beatles' success until his premature death next an o.d. of sleeping pills in 1967, at the age of 32. He was troubled by the need to hide his homoeroticism from the public oculus, a national the ring referenced with the song You've Got To Hide Your Love Away.

Also included in the auction is the pianoforte used by the Beatles for their recording of Hey Jude and by David Bowie in his Ziggy Stardust period, which is expected to fetch up to �400,000.

He loved hip-hop growing up, just the simply R&B he could get into was R. Kelly. But when his friends heard his perfect tenor voice, they pushed Trey Songz to drop blame and initiate crooning. He did, and after triumphant legion talent shows in his aboriginal Petersburg, VA, the 15-year-old isaac Bashevis Singer met Troy Taylor, wHO had worked slow the scenes with Patti LaBelle, SWV, and B2K. Taylor bucked up Trey to refinement high schooltime, and then they could give tongue to around a possible euphony career. Trey got his sheepskin and immediately touched to New Jersey to put to work with Taylor. Soon the isaac Bashevis Singer was approaching into judicature on Kevin Lyttle's debut album and Trick Daddy's Hoodlum Matrimony as a sideman as well as breaking extinct on his possess with his solo cut, "Around the Game," from the Handler Carter soundtrack. As he was on the job on his debut record album -- and some collaborations with Lil' Kim, Trina, and Snoop Dogg -- he released some street-level mixtapes under his sham name, the Prince of Virginia. His proper debut, Gotta Make It, was released by Atlantic in 2005.

Watch Pete Doherty's Three Step Guide To Getting To A Gig

Babyshambles frontman Pete Doherty has revealed a three step video guide on how he gets ready for one of his gigs.



The videos, which were published on the video sharing website YouTube yesterday (June 17th), begin just after the singer has woken up.



From his bedside, Doherty then takes the viewer into the bath where he talks to the camera about his relationship with the media.



“First things first we've got to scrub up, look our best,” Doherty explains.



“Mind you, to be honest with you, it doesn't matter how good you make yourself look, if they catch you sneezing they'll you've been bang at it all night.”



Throughout the videos, which end with the singer getting dressed, Doherty's manager can be heard urging the performer to hurry up.
